Abstract

The invention discloses a kind of pipeline emergency maintenance sealing device and methods, if described device includes: half flange of upper left, half flange of lower-left, half flange of upper right, half flange of bottom right, sealing element, bolt stem;Half flange of upper left and half flange of lower-left are bolted to form left flange;Half flange of upper right and half flange of bottom right are bolted to form right flange;Left flange and right flange hold half flange of upper left tightly with Pipe installing respectively and the compression load for forming vertical direction to sealing element are bolted with half flange of bottom right and fastens to sealing element with half flange of lower-left, half flange of upper right;Half flange of upper left is bolted the compression load for forming horizontal direction to sealing element with half flange of bottom right and fastens to sealing element with half flange of upper right, half flange of lower-left;The present apparatus solves pipeline prevention and emergency maintenance technical problem under small space, high temperature and pressure harsh environment, is pipeline-like parts for maintenance, provides indispensable device and method.

Background technique
Be on active service under high temperature, high pressure, the bad working environments of the radiation for a long time rate that breaks down of bearing pipe base part is higher, once Pipeline leaks, and there is very big risk for the safe operation of equipment.The maintenance of such pipeline is long in the prevalence of the period, The features such as costly.
Come from presently disclosed document, most pipeline maintenances both for conventional pipeline, using conventional method, it is such as straight Welding is connect, will receive the items such as pipe wall thickness, soldering appliance and material preparation, operating space and welder technology level Part limitation;Pipe end adds pipe cap or valve, and the implementation of this method is more complex, needs to carry out original pipeline certain destruction;Tube wall Adding holding card, this method is suitable for normal temperature and pressure occasion, and it is easy to operate, but since sealing element is easy to aging, the time cycle used has Limitation;More renew pipe, this method is more complex, needs to remove old pipe, installs new pipe
Summary of the invention
To implement the emergency maintenance to pipe leakage, realizes Management of Pipeline Mechanical Equipment maintenance process demand, solve small space, high temperature Pipeline prevention and emergency maintenance technical problem, develop a set of mechanically-sealing apparatus and installation method, for pipe under high pressure harsh environment The maintenance of road base part, provides indispensable device and method.
To the defect of some special weld seams and pipeline be badly in need of it is a kind of prevention, emergency maintenance measure, realize such defect repair Quick emergency response, guarantee the safe operation of equipment.For the leakage of pipeline, a set of mechanically-sealing apparatus is had developed, is being lacked Sealing ring is installed around sunken, certain pretightning force is provided by sealing device, sealing ring is compressed, formation one is closed Defect is isolated from the outside by space.
Method used in the present invention be different from existing method, using flange-type structure, upper and lower two groups of flanges respectively with pipe Road installation is held tightly, and high temperature high voltage resistant sealing element is located at pipe leakage point outer surface, flange inner surface, the bolt between the flange of left and right Compressing force is provided, sealing element is pressed on leakage point, the leakage sealed of pipeline is realized.Sealing device design principle is correct, Process stability that is reasonable in design, establishing is strong, easily operated, and maintenance cycle is short, especially suitable for needing dimension of meeting an urgent need The occasion repaired.

Pipeline sealing device is as shown in Figure 1, 2.The present invention describes: a kind of pipeline emergency maintenance sealing device, can Realize the prevention and emergency maintenance of high-temperature and pressure pipeline leakage, main structure includes mounting flange, sealing element, bolt, washer Deng.Wherein sealing element is that high temperature resistant, corrosion-resistant, anti-radiation graphite material fabricate.
The present apparatus is directed to the emergency maintenance of high-temperature and pressure pipeline, and innovation has developed Purely mechanical sealing device and installation side Method.Present apparatus installation is easy to operate, makes sealing element using high temperature resistant, corrosion-resistant, radiation resistance material, can be used for bearing pipe and let out The prevention and emergency maintenance of leakage.The present apparatus uses button type flange arrangement, holds tightly in vertical direction and pipeline, leads in the horizontal direction It crosses bolt offer pretightning force to compress sealing element, solves whole device and pipeline fixed constraint problem.
When pipeline leaks, using the maintenance process of the present apparatus are as follows:
(1) a leakage point scheduled exterior surface area nearby is removed, is positioned at flange A, flange B near leakage point, and It is installed together by bolt group 10, washer sets 9, is adjacent to pipeline outer wall;
(2) two pieces sealing element 5 is inserted into the gap between pipeline and flange respectively, by 5 seam of sealing element and flange A, method Blue B seam is staggered;
(3) installation the right flange D, flange C, and be installed together by bolt group 10, washer sets 9, it is adjacent to pipeline outer wall;
(4) flange A is connected with flange D, flange C with flange B by multiple bolts 7, and the shape on the sealing element 5 At compression load;
(5) preset pretightning force is symmetrically applied to bolt group 7, forms compression load on the sealing element 5.
This application involves a kind of sealing device specials, the emergency maintenance for the leakage of pipeline base part.The device uses method Blue formula structure, the parts such as Zuo Falan, right flange, sealing element, bolt, two groups of flanges are held tightly with Pipe installing respectively, sealing element position In pipe leakage point outer surface, flange inner surface, the bolt between left and right flanges provides compressing force, and sealing element is pressed on and is let out On leak source, the leakage sealed of pipeline is realized.
The present apparatus is used for the emergency maintenance of pipeline base part leakage, and the sealing device includes: two left flanges, two right sides Flange, the flange include a semicylinder and a step, and a sealing element contacts the outer surface of leakage pipe, to prevent from leaking, One group of bolt is used to hold tightly flange and pipeline, and one group of flange is used to fastening load passing to sealing element from flange.
The corresponding method of the present apparatus includes the following steps: to remove near leakage point for repairing the leakage of pipeline base part One scheduled exterior surface area is positioned at two left flanges near leakage point, and is fitted together by bolt, by a sealing Part is inserted into the gap between pipeline and flange, and left and right flange is connected by two flanges of installation the right by multiple connectors, and Compression load is formed on the sealing element, to prevent from leaking again.
